Holdfast Project Space for Families
Thu 12 Dec - Sat 29 Feb 2020 / First Floor Gallery
Come along and enjoy the interactive Project Space in the First Floor Gallery, designed specifically for children by Orla Goodwin. There are free art activities for all to enjoy that connect to the exhibition ‘Holdfast’ by Ann Ensor, which is showing in the Ground Floor Gallery. You are invited to engage with the themes and ideas presented in ‘Holdfast’ in a creative, fun way. Explore the space with your child in your own time over the course of the exhibition or come along on a day when one of our artists will be on hand for some creative guidance (see times and dates below for guided engagement). You can draw, read, watch and make, as you learn more about the wonders of kelp and the important role we all play in keeping our kelp forests healthy.

Fingal County Council Arts Office presents a new commission Holdfast from Ann Ensor for the 12th edition of Amharc Fhine Gall in collaboration with Draíocht. Holdfast is an immersive installation combining sculpture, drawing, sound and text which explores the aesthetic properties and the environmental significance of kelp seaweed. This is Draíocht’s first exhibition to address directly the issue of climate change.
